Philadelphia Highway Patrol officer critically injured in crash

Officer Andy Chan remains in critical but stable condition following brain surgery

A Philadelphia Highway Patrol Officer was critically injured Thursday night after being hit by another vehicle on his motorcycle.

Officer Andy Chan is in critical but stable condition following brain surgery needed after the crash, ABC 6 Action News reports. Doctors are conducting minute-by-minute “aggressive monitoring” on Chan’s condition. There hasn’t been much change in Chan’s status, but the next 72 hours are crucial.

“It’s good news in the sense that there’s not a lot of change. Because of the significant injury that he sustained, that’s actually a good sign right now,” Philadelphia Police Commissioner Richard Ross said.

Chan was transported to a local hospital with a large police escort after the crash. His wife and son are with him.
